In the modern world, technology plays a crucial role in various industries, especially in the fields of engineering and environmental science. One of the vital tools that have emerged is the flow rate detector, which is essential for measuring the flow of liquids and gases in different applications. Understanding how this device works and its significance can provide insights into its importance in both industrial and domestic settings.A flow rate detector is an instrument used to measure the volume of fluid that passes through a given point in a specified period. This measurement is crucial for several reasons. First, it helps in monitoring the efficiency of systems that rely on fluid movement, such as water supply networks, oil pipelines, and chemical processing plants. By knowing the flow rate, operators can ensure that systems are functioning optimally, avoiding potential issues such as leaks or blockages.Moreover, in the environmental sector, a flow rate detector is instrumental in assessing water quality and availability. For instance, in rivers and streams, monitoring the flow rate can help determine the health of aquatic ecosystems. Changes in flow can indicate pollution or other environmental concerns, prompting necessary actions to protect these natural resources.Additionally, in residential settings, flow rate detectors are becoming increasingly popular. Homeowners can install these devices to monitor water usage, helping them manage consumption and reduce costs. With the growing awareness of water conservation, having a clear understanding of flow rates can encourage more responsible usage and conservation practices.The technology behind flow rate detectors has evolved significantly over the years. Initially, mechanical devices were used, which relied on moving parts to measure flow. However, modern detectors often use electronic sensors that provide more accurate and reliable measurements. These advancements have made it possible to integrate flow rate detection into automated systems, allowing for real-time monitoring and control.Furthermore, the data collected by flow rate detectors can be analyzed to improve system designs and operational strategies. For example, engineers can use flow data to optimize pipeline designs, ensuring minimal loss and maximum efficiency. In industrial applications, this data can lead to significant cost savings and improved safety measures.In conclusion, the flow rate detector is an indispensable tool in our technologically driven world. Its ability to accurately measure fluid flow not only enhances operational efficiency across various industries but also plays a crucial role in environmental protection and resource management. As technology continues to advance, the capabilities and applications of flow rate detectors will undoubtedly expand, making them even more valuable in our quest for sustainability and efficiency. Understanding and utilizing these devices will be essential for future innovations in fluid dynamics and resource management.
